[0006]Briefly described, in architecture, one of many possible embodiments is a programmable device that provides a user application and is configured to communicate with a network. The programmable device may comprise a processing device configured to control the operation of the programmable device, a user interface configured to enable a user to interact with the user application, a network interface device configured to enable the programmable device to communicate with the network, and memory comprising the user application and logic configured to provide user-specific data associated with the user application to the network. The user-specific data may comprise information capable of being used to configure a replacement programmable device for the user.

Problems solved by technology

When a programmable device is lost, stolen, or becomes inoperable, a user is not able to use the programmable device until it is recovered and / or repaired.
Even if the programmable device is not essential for performing job functions, users may still experience varying levels of inconvenience or frustration when the programmable device is no longer available for use.
Obviously, such a loss is undesirable and problematic.

I. System Overview

[0020]FIG. 1 illustrates a system 100 for providing support services to a plurality of programmable devices. System 100 may comprise a user support services center 102, various programmable devices 103, users 112, and communications network 114. Each user 112 may have one or more programmable devices 103, each of which are configured to communicate with user support services center 102 via communications network 114.

[0021]Communications network 114 may be any type of communication network employing any network topology, transmission medium, or network protocol. For example, communications network 114 may be a local area network (LAN), a metropolitan area network (MAN), a wide area network (WAN), any public or private packet-switched or other data network, including the Internet, circuit-switched networks, such as the public switched telephone network (PSTN), wireless networks, or any other desired communications infrastructure.

Abstract

Systems and methods for providing support services to users of programmable devices are provided. One of many possible methods for providing support services for a plurality of programmable devices associated with a plurality of users involves the steps of: receiving user-specific data associated with one of the programmable devices and the corresponding user; storing the user-specific data associated with the programmable device and the corresponding user; receiving notification that a replacement programmable device for the programmable device is needed by the user; and configuring the replacement programmable device based on the user-specific data associated with the programmable device and the corresponding user. The method may further involve the steps of: providing the replacement programmable device to the user; receiving the programmable device; repairing the programmable device; providing the repaired programmable device to the user; receiving the replacement programmable device from the user; and receiving payment for providing the support services to the user.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ention is generally related to systems and methods for providing technical support to users of personal computers.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Presently, there are numerous types of programmable devices, such as, personal computers (PCs), laptop PCs, personal digital assistants (PDAs), and wireless telephones to name a few, that provide applications to users and which are configured to communicate with a communications network. These programmable devices may be configured with any of a variety of user applications. For instance, laptops and personal computers are typically configured to provide word processing applications, spreadsheet applications, presentation applications, e-mail client applications, web browser applications, financial applications, enterprise applications, and other desirable applications. PDAs are typically configured with calendar applications, task and contact management applications, financial applications, and others....
